Principal Surveyor – Fire Safety
Newham
Up to £565.00 Daily Inside IR35
Contract
My client is looking for a professional to be responsible a professional housing surveying service, all technical aspects of the repair, maintenance, improvement, and re-servicing of all council owned, managed and leased stock in accordance with organisation’s policies and procedures.
Responsibilities
* To routinely monitor and review the economy, efficiency, effectiveness and quality of current services across the Asset Management Group, developing new approaches to the challenges presented and implementing improvements that are in line with overriding strategic objectives, aims and targets, setting standards for the London Borough of Newham that result in continuous service improvement.
* To ensure an efficient and effective technical support service for the Asset Management Group, covering specialist services with Fire Safety as the main focus of activity.
* To manage the development of collaborative working with chosen contractors and strategic alliance partners, co-ordinating and integrating essential activities such as supply chain management, specification development, and consultation with stakeholders. To develop project specific briefs to ensure all projects meet Newham Council’s’ objectives and comply with the contractual terms of any agreement to ensure best value in cost, performance, quality and future maintenance.
* To produce contract documentation for invitations to tender, examine tenders and recommend contractors for appointment, using expert knowledge
* To monitor and manage the Fire Safety service, to ensure the team surpass the aims and objectives regarding delivery, on time and to budget and to the necessary quality, by using their knowledge and skills in the field of construction and financial control. To arrange, the effective ‘handover’ at completion, so that the resident satisfaction and desired quality is surpassed.
* To attend meetings on behalf of the organisation and report to senior managers and other staff, residents bodies on issues related to the Housing Capital Programme or schemes within it.
* To investigate complaints against contractors or partners, deal with contractual disputes and where necessary refer to arbitration or litigation. To deal with correspondence and investigate complaints associated with technical matters, including providing reports and responses to Ombudsman enquiries within targets.
To apply for this position, you will need considerable experience of building inspection work, identifying faults, preparing reports/specifications plus, extensive experience in dealing with Fire Safety works and Fire Risk Assessments. Have a relevant degree and/or full membership of the RCIS or equivalent.
